    The Zlob Trojan, identified by some anti-virus Trojans as zlob, is a simple Trojan horse that masquerades in accordance with the required video codec in an ActiveX image. This was first seen at the end of 2005, but only started in mid-2006. [1]

    Once installed, this task will display pop-up advertisements related to genuine Microsoft Windows alerts and notify the user that the laptop is infected with spyware. Clicking on multiple popsThis launches the download of a fake anti-spyware program (such as Virus Heat MS and Antivirus (Antivirus 2009)), which usually hides the Trojan. [1]

    The Trojan is also similar to atnvrsinstall Download.exe, which uses our Windows Security Shield icon to look as if it were an antivirus installation from a Microsoft file.     The group behind Zlob also developed a Mac Trojan with similar behavior (called RSPlug). [6] Some variations of the beloved Zlob, such as the so-called “DNSChanger” DNS name servers on Windows computers [7] and try to hack every router you find, to change your DNS settings and hopefully redirect traffic from legitimate websites so others can see suspicious websites. [8] DNSChanger received a lot of attention when the US FBI announced in late November 2011 that it had disabled the source of adware and spyware.
